Online gambling laws vary significantly from one country to another, shaping the landscape for operators and players alike. In some jurisdictions, online gambling is strictly prohibited, while others have embraced it with robust regulatory frameworks.

Europe stands out as a region with a diverse approach to online gambling. Countries like the United Kingdom have well-established regulatory bodies that oversee the industry, ensuring consumer protection and responsible gaming practices. On the other hand, countries like Germany have faced challenges in reconciling their state-specific regulations with overarching EU laws.

In Asia, online gambling laws are a mix of strict prohibitions and more permissive attitudes. While countries like Singapore have banned online gambling activities, others like the Philippines have developed thriving online gambling industries with regulated markets. Key Licensing Bodies

Key licensing bodies worldwide regulate and oversee online gambling operations, ensuring compliance with legal standards and industry regulations.

Some of the prominent licensing authorities include the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), Gibraltar Regulatory Authority, and Alderney Gambling Control Commission.

The UKGC is known for its strict standards in ensuring consumer protection and responsible gaming practices. The MGA is recognized for its robust regulatory framework, making Malta a hub for online gambling operators.

The Gibraltar Regulatory Authority offers licenses to operators meeting high standards of integrity and player protection. The Alderney Gambling Control Commission is respected for its focus on fair gaming and player security, attracting reputable online gambling businesses to its jurisdiction.

Responsible Gambling Practices

Implementing effective responsible gambling practices is crucial for maintaining a safe and sustainable online gambling environment. Responsible gambling includes measures to prevent problem gambling and protect vulnerable individuals. Online gambling operators are increasingly implementing tools such as self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and reality checks to help players manage their gambling habits. These tools empower players to set limits on their spending, time spent gambling, and access to certain games.

Furthermore, responsible gambling practices involve providing resources for players to seek help if needed. Many online gambling websites offer links to support organizations and helplines for individuals struggling with gambling addiction. It’s essential for operators to promote responsible gambling through educational materials and clear information on where to find help.

Encryption for Security

To enhance the security of your online gambling transactions, prioritize utilizing encryption technology to safeguard your payment information and personal data. Encryption plays a crucial role in protecting sensitive data by converting it into a code that can only be deciphered with the appropriate key.

Look for online gambling platforms that use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ption, which is a standard security protocol for establishing encrypted links between a web server and a browser. This encryption method ensures that any information you enter on the site, such as credit card details or personal information, is securely transmitted and protected from unauthorized access.

Tips for a Safe Online Gambling Experience

For a safe online gambling experience, it’s essential to implement robust security measures to protect your personal and financial information. Start by choosing reputable online casinos that are licensed and regulated. Look for secure websites with SSL encryption to safeguard your data during transactions. Create strong, unique passwords for your gambling accounts and enable two-factor authentication for an extra layer of security.

Avoid sharing sensitive information like your credit card details or personal identification unless you’re confident about the website’s credibility. Be cautious of phishing scams and never click on suspicious links or download attachments from unknown sources. Regularly review your account activity and report any unauthorized transactions immediately to the online casino and your financial institution.

Furthermore, it’s advisable to set limits on your gambling activities to prevent overspending. Stay informed about responsible gambling practices and seek help if you feel your gaming habits are becoming problematic. By following these tips, you can enjoy a safer online gambling experience.
